Innovation is at the core of our approach to client feedback at ETTE. We've implemented cloud-based solutions to digitize our feedback collection and analysis, allowing us to gather data in real-time from our diverse users. One specific approach is the utilization of advanced analytics which helps us understand the specifics of how our IT solutions are being used and what changes would make them better. For example, when we worked with a client to move their IT infrastructure to our data center, we used the analytical data captured to proactively identify potential bottlenecks and improve their data management strategy. We also ensure constant engagement with our clients through regular training sessions, which also double as feedback sessions. It's a win-win: as our clients stay updated with evolving standards and technologies, we also gain crucial insights to enhance our solutions.

One innovative approach we've embraced to gather and implement client feedback involves leveraging artificial intelligence tools to analyze customer interactions and sentiments. By utilizing natural language processing algorithms, we can sift through vast amounts of customer feedback from various channels, such as social media, emails, and surveys, to identify recurring themes and sentiments. This data-driven approach enables us to pinpoint specific areas of improvement or highlight aspects of our products and services that resonate positively with clients. Integrating this AI-driven feedback analysis into our decision-making processes has allowed us to swiftly adapt and fine-tune our business operations based on real-time customer insights, fostering a more responsive and customer-centric approach to our operations.

Establish a client feedback advisory board consisting of select clients who provide regular feedback. This board can provide valuable insights, test new products/services, and shape business operations effectively. By involving them in decision-making processes, businesses strengthen client relationships and gain committed stakeholders. Example: ABC Company forms a board of its top clients, representing different industries and demographics. The board meets quarterly to discuss new ideas, provide feedback, and brainstorm improvements. ABC Company then uses this input to drive strategic decisions and enhance its operations.

Develop a gamified feedback system where clients earn points or rewards for providing valuable feedback, encouraging active participation and making the process more enjoyable. By implementing game elements, such as badges, levels, or leaderboards, clients will be motivated to provide feedback, leading to increased engagement and a larger pool of valuable insights. For example, a software company could create a feedback platform where clients earn 'bug hunter' badges for reporting software issues, 'innovation guru' badges for suggesting new features, and 'customer champion' badges for helping other clients on the platform. This approach not only incentivizes feedback but also fosters a sense of community and friendly competition among clients, resulting in a stronger client-business relationship and continuous improvement of business operations.
